| Item 1 Comment: This Amendment No. 3 ("Amendment No. 3") amends the Schedule 13D (the "Original Schedule 13D"), Amendment No. 1 to the Original Schedule 13D ("Amendment No. 1") and Amendment No. 2 to the Original Schedule 13D ("Amendment No. 2"), filed by the Reporting Person with the SEC on April 5, 2004, January 19, 2006 and February 15, 2024, respectively, with respect to the Series A Shares of common stock, no par value (the "A Shares"), the Series B Shares of common stock, no par value (the "B Shares"), the Dividend Preferred Shares, no par value (the "D Shares"), and the limited-voting Series L Shares, no par value ("L Shares" and, together with the A Shares, the B Shares and the D Shares, the "Shares") of Grupo Televisa, S.A.B. (the "Issuer"). This Amendment No. 3 supplements Items 4, 6 and 7 and amends and restates Items 2(e) and 5(a)-(c) as set forth below. Except as set forth herein, in Amendment No. 1 and in Amendment No. 2, the information in the Original 13D is unchanged and has been omitted from this Amendment No. 3. Unless otherwise defined herein, capitalized terms used herein shall have the meanings ascribed thereto in the Original 13D. The Shares trade on the Mexican Stock Exchange in the form of certificados de participacion ordinarios ("CPOs"), each of which currently comprises of 25 A Shares, 22 B Shares, 35 D Shares and 35 L Shares, and in the United States, in the form of global depositary shares, each of which represent 5 CPOs. | |

| Item 4. | Purpose of Transaction |
On January 5, 2026, the Reporting Person and the Azcarraga Trust entered into a transaction agreement (the "Transaction Agreement") with Alfonso de Angoitia Noriega ("AAN") and Bernardo Gomez Martinez ("BGM"), pursuant to which the Reporting Person agreed to sell to AAN 13,166,166,402 A Shares and to BGM 13,166,166,402 A Shares (collectively, the "Acquired Shares"), for an aggregate purchase price of Ps.1,926,303,610.
Pursuant to the Transaction Agreement, each of AAN and BGM agreed that following their acquisition of the Acquired Shares, the Reporting Person, through the Azcarraga Trust, will have the right to exercise all voting rights attached to the Acquired Shares, together with 38,580,509 CPOs held by AAN prior to the entry into the Transaction Agreement (the "A Specified CPOs") and 38,699,325 CPOs held by BGM prior to the entry into the Transaction Agreement (the "B Specified CPOs"), with respect to the appointment, removal and/or ratification of members of the Issuer's board of directors ("Special Voting Rights") so long as the Reporting Person is not declared legally dead, incapacitated or absent and holds more than fifty-percent (50%) of the shares in the Azcarraga Trust, other than the Acquired Shares. Each of AAN and BGM will have the right to exercise all voting rights attached to each of their Acquired Shares and the A Specified CPOs and B Specified CPOs, respectively, other than those specified in the preceding sentence.
In addition, under the Transaction Agreement, in the event that the Reporting Person, directly or through the Azcarraga Trust, AAN or BGM intend to transfer the Acquired Shares or any other shares of or securities representing the Issuer's capital stock (including CPOs or global depositary shares), the other parties thereto will have a right of first refusal allowing them to purchase such shares or securities at the proposed sale price.
The acquisition of the Acquired Shares contemplated by the Transaction Agreement is subject to certain closing conditions, including receipt of required regulatory approval in Mexico.
The foregoing summary of the Transaction Agreement does not purport to be complete and is qualified in its entirety by reference to the Transaction Agreement, a copy of which is filed as Exhibit 99.3 to this Amendment No. 3 and incorporated herein by reference. | |

Trust No. 11042181 (the "LTRP Trust") is a trust organized under the laws of Mexico as an equity compensation plan for employees of the Issuer. The LTRP Trust holds the following Shares as of September 30, 2025: 7,339,790,761 A Shares, 6,701,667,681 B Shares, 6,911,937,709 D Shares and 6,911,937,709 L Shares. These shares are not included in the number of A Shares, B Shares, D Shares and L Shares included in items 7 through 10 of the coverage pages to this Amendment No. 3. Shares held in the LTRP Trust become vested over a period of years, reducing the number of Shares held in the LTRP Trust accordingly. A technical committee, all of whose members are employees of the Issuer, has the power to control the voting of Shares held by the LTRP Trust. Thus, the LTRP Trust may be deemed to be controlled by the Issuer, and the Issuer and EAJ may be deemed to share beneficial ownership of all Shares beneficially owned by the LTRP Trust. EAJ expressly disclaims such beneficial ownership. |

FIFTH. Right of First Refusal
In the event that (i) EAJ, whether directly, through the Control Trust or indirectly in any other way, intends to carry out a transfer of shares representing the capital stock of the Company and/or rights under the Control Trust, whatever the form or structure of the sale or assignment (the “EAJ Securities”), or (ii) AAN and/or BGM intend to carry out a transfer, either directly, indirectly or otherwise, of the Shares to be Acquired, then EAJ through the Control Trust, AAN and BGM, as the case may be, will have a right of first offer as follows:
| a. | The Party or Parties that intend to carry out a transfer as set forth above (either one or two Parties, the “Selling Party”) shall deliver to the other Parties (either one or two Parties, the “Prospective Acquirers”) a notice offering to sell or assign, as the case may be, the number of EAJ Securities or Shares to be Acquired, as applicable, subject matter of the potential transfer (the “Offered Securities”), indicating the cash price at which the Offered Securities are proposed to be transferred (the “Sale Price”) and the other relevant terms and conditions of the transfer (the “Offer to Sell”). |
| b. | Prospective Acquirers shall have the right to acquire the Securities Offered at the Sale Price, proportionally with respect to their respective direct and indirect participation in the capital stock of the Company (excluding, for these purposes, all other shareholders of the Company who are not Prospective Acquirers) by delivery, within twenty (20) business days following the date on which they have received the Offer to Sell, a written notice to the Selling Party confirming its intent to acquire all and not less than all of the Offered Securities to which it is entitled (the “Purchase Notice”). For the purposes of determining the participation of the Prospective Acquirers in the Company, the direct and indirect participation of such Prospective Acquirerson the day immediately prior to the day on which the Offer for Sale is delivered shall be considered. |
| c. | In the event that there is more than one Prospective Acquirer, if any Prospective Acquirer delivers a Purchase Notice indicating its intention to purchase a number of Offered Securities less than that to which it would be entitled, or fails to deliver the Purchase Notice within the period indicated above, the Offered Securities corresponding to such Prospective Acquirer must be offered directly to the other Prospective Acquirers who have indicated their intention to acquire the Offered Securities, which such other Prospective Acquirers who will have an additional period of twenty (20) business days to deliver a written notice to the Selling Party confirming their intent to acquire all or part of the additional Offered Securities. |
3
| d. | In the event that the Prospective Acquirers do not accept the Offer to Sell as indicated in the preceding paragraphs within the deadlines established above, the Selling Party may offer the Offered Securities not accepted to a third party at a price that is not less than the Sale Price and on terms and conditions that are not more favorable to the third party than those offered to the Prospective Acquirers. |
| e. | If the Selling Party does not complete the transfer of the declined Offered Securities within a period of one hundred twenty (120) days (according to which such period must be extended to obtain the authorization of the National Antitrust Commission if required in accordance with applicable law) as of the date on which the Offer to Sell is deemed to have been declined in accordance with the preceding paragraphs, then the Selling Party may not transfer the Offered Securities to any third party until it goes over the procedure provided for in this Clause Fifth again. |
